(Monday, November 10, 1969) — Jim Morrison, lead singer of The Doors rock group, pleaded not guilty at his arraignment in Dade Criminal Court today on a host of charges stemming from a wild performance at Dinner Key Auditorium in Miami on Mar. 1, 1969. (Thursday, November 6, 1969, 9:00-10:00 p.m. BST) — Ringo Starr of The Beatles recorded his vocals for “Stormy Weather” tonight at Wessex Sound Studios in London for his debut solo album Sentimental Journey. (Wednesday, November 5, 1969) — The Doors recorded “Roadhouse Blues” and “Money Beats Soul” today at Elektra Sound Recorders in Los Angeles during sessions for the group’s next studio album Morrison Hotel. (Wednesday, November 5, 1969) — John Lennon of The Beatles and his wife, Yoko Ono, were separately filmed today at their Tittenhurst Park estate near Ascot, England, for their contribution in the band’s promotional film for the recently released “Something” single. (Sunday, November 2, 1969, 8:00-9:00 p.m. EST) — The Band performed “Up on Cripple Creek” and Petula Clark sang “The Fool On The Hill,” written by John Lennon and Paul McCartney of The Beatles, on tonight’s edition of the CBS-TV variety series The Ed Sullivan Show live from the Ed Sullivan Theater in New York City. (Saturday, November 1, 1969)Abbey Road, the eleventh studio album by English rock band The Beatles, the last in which all four members participated, peaked at #1 on today’s Billboard Top LP’s chart for 11 non-consecutive weeks (Nov. 1/8/15/22/29, Dec. 6/13/20, 1969, Jan. 3/10/24, 1970). (Saturday, November 1, 1969)The Monkees Present, The Monkees’ eighth studio album, the last to feature Michael Nesmith and the second after Peter Tork left the group, debuted at #187 on today’s Billboard Top LP’s chart. (Monday, October 27, 1969, 2:30-5:00 p.m./7:00-9:30 p.m. BST) — Ringo Starr of The Beatles began recording his first solo studio album today at EMI Studio 3 in London, capturing “Night and Day” in two sessions.
